Output 84ca960b283f7a1d1c395ca63d510e4fbab6da99f8ae3e95453bf15facbaaa44:0

value
44880180
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ae1706dc362037d26c4311e068e1f57f5c9f1a2 OP_EQUALVERIFY OP_CHECKSIG
address
19HXt461A3WRMMXhpLhAHoKw3TLGPJhSyb
transaction
84ca960b283f7a1d1c395ca63d510e4fbab6da99f8ae3e95453bf15facbaaa44
confirmations
530113
spent
true